Sunday, 6th November 2022 - Part 2 - Faith is a journey, Job affirms the living God 09.11.2023 17:55
The book of Job is full of turmoil and despair, but it also contains a significant declaration of Job's faith in the living God. In Job's greatest moment of despair, his faith appears at its highest. Job is keen to ensure that others know that it is not his sin that has led him to the life he has been required to navigate. Job's declaration reveals an understanding of the "now and not yet" of the...
